最近项目需要用到数组维度转换,网上资源较少,写一个分享与备用 1.一维数组转二维数组 2.一维数组转三维数组 3.二维数组转一维数组 4.三维数组转一维数组 ...
最近项目需要用到数组维度转换,网上资源较少,写一个分享与备用 1.一维数组转二维数组 2.一维数组转三维数组 3.二维数组转一维数组 4.三维数组转一维数组 ...
数组(Array):相同类型数据的集合就叫做数组。 (一)定义数组的方法: A) type[] 变量名 = new type[数组中元素的个数] 例如: int[] a = new int[10] ; 或者 int a[] = new int[10]; B)type ...
...
一维数组:int a[c],其中a是数组名称,c是数组维度,数组维度必须是常量表达式!例如: 数组的初始化: 数组元素的访问可以通过数组名+下标号访问,此处应注意的问题是数组的下标是否在合理范围之内(这是有程序员负责检查的),当下标越界 ...
记得刚学习C++那会这个问题曾困扰过我,后来慢慢形成了不管什么时候都用一维数组的习惯,再后来知道了在一维数组中提出首列元素地址进行二维调用的办法。可从来没有细想过这个问题,最近自己写了点代码测试下,虽然还是有些不明就里,不过结果挺有意思。 为了避免编译器优化过度,用的是写操作,int,测试分为 ...
...
1 数组嵌套的知识1维数组的嵌套并非2维数组二维数组的嵌套并非三维数组 2 数组的嵌套写法1维数组的嵌套:arr(m)(i)2维数组的嵌套:arr(m)(i,j)Sub test1001() Debug.Print "测试一维数组和其嵌套"'一维数组arr1 = Array ...
一维数组的遍历遍历:就是将集合内容进行逐个的访问。(例如:课堂上的点名)是利用循环进行的,是通过数组的索引值进行计数循环,从而达到遍历数组元素的目的。使用for这种循环进行数组的遍历。由于for本身是一种计数器循环所以很容易的就和数组的索引值结合,这是天然的结合。通过这种结合就可以轻松的遍历数组中 ...